#c# #excel #ms-office #epplus
Вопрос:
в этом коде я импортирую данные с листа Excel в таблицу данных с помощью Epplus 5.6.4
using(var report = new ExcelPackage(report_path))
{
var x_sheet = report.Workbook.Worksheets["sheet1"];
var dt_x_sheet = x_sheet.Cells["A:F"].ToDataTable();
}
Я получаю следующую ошибку:
Система.Исключение InvalidOperationException: ‘Значение не может быть нулевым, строка: 474, col: 5
- как импортировать данные, даже если ячейка имеет нулевое значение.
- Как импортировать данные и исключить строки с определенным условием ячейки, например, исключить строку, если столбец 5 имеет значение null.
Ответ №1:
Это была ошибка в EPPlus, и она была исправлена в версии 5.7.